大数跨境

OpenClaw(龙虾)在群晖NAS怎么修复闪退实战教程

2026-03-19 1
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一款面向跨境电商卖家的第三方 NAS 应用,用于在群晖 DSM 系统中部署轻量级数据采集与监控服务(如订单同步、库存抓取、价格追踪等)。它非群晖官方应用,需手动安装 .spk 包;‘闪退’指启动后立即崩溃或无响应,属常见兼容性问题。

 

要点速读(TL;DR)

  • OpenClaw(龙虾)闪退主因:DSM 版本不兼容、架构不匹配(x86/ARM)、依赖库缺失、权限配置错误;
  • 修复核心步骤:确认硬件平台 → 下载对应架构包 → 手动启用 SSH → 补全 libstdc++/glibc → 调整 app 权限与日志路径;
  • 不建议在 DSM 7.2+ 新版系统上直接安装旧版 OpenClaw,优先查证开发者是否发布适配更新。

它能解决哪些问题

  • 场景痛点:卖家用群晖跑 OpenClaw 抓取 Amazon/Shopee 订单,但应用启动即退出 → 价值:恢复基础数据采集能力,避免人工导单延误发货;
  • 场景痛点:升级 DSM 后 OpenClaw 黑屏/无日志 → 价值:定位底层依赖断裂点,规避盲目重装导致配置丢失;
  • 场景痛点:多台 NAS 中仅某台闪退(同版本 DSM)→ 价值:识别硬件架构差异(如 DS920+ x86 vs DS220+ ARM),实现精准包匹配。

怎么用/怎么修复闪退(实操步骤)

以下为经跨境卖家实测验证的通用修复流程(基于 DSM 7.1–7.2 环境,ARM/x86 均适用):

  1. 确认 NAS 型号与 CPU 架构:进入「控制面板 > 信息中心」,记录「型号」及「处理器架构」(如 Intel Celeron J4125 / Realtek RTD1619B);
  2. 核对 OpenClaw 版本兼容性:访问 OpenClaw 官方 GitHub Release 页面(或可信镜像源),筛选标注 armada37xx(ARM)、apollolake(x86)等关键词的 .spk 包;
  3. 启用 SSH 并登录:「控制面板 > 终端机和 SNMP > 启用 SSH 服务」→ 使用 PuTTY 或 Terminal 连接(admin 账户 + 管理员密码);
  4. 补全系统依赖库(关键步骤):执行:sudo /var/packages/OpenClaw/target/usr/bin/ldd /var/packages/OpenClaw/target/bin/openclaw | grep "not found";若输出缺失 libstdc++.so.6libgcc_s.so.1,则需从群晖官方 Tool Chain 对应版本下载并软链至 /lib
  5. 修正日志路径权限:执行:sudo chown -R admin:users /var/packages/OpenClaw/target/var/log;确保 OpenClaw 进程有写入权限;
  6. 重启服务并验证:执行:sudo synoservice --restart pkgctl-OpenClaw → 查看实时日志:sudo tail -f /var/packages/OpenClaw/target/var/log/openclaw.log,确认无 Segmentation faultcannot open shared object file 报错。

费用/成本影响因素

OpenClaw(龙虾)本身为开源免费工具,无许可费;修复过程不产生直接费用。但以下因素影响实施成本:

  • 卖家自身 Linux 基础能力(是否需付费请人调试);
  • 所用 NAS 型号是否被社区广泛支持(冷门型号可能需自行交叉编译);
  • 是否依赖额外插件(如 Python 3.9 环境、jq 工具)而需手动部署;
  • 修复失败后数据迁移/重配置耗时(影响运营连续性)。

为获得准确实施支持成本,你通常需提供:NAS 型号、DSM 版本号、OpenClaw 安装包 SHA256 校验值、openclaw.log 截图(含报错行)。

常见坑与避坑清单

  • ❌ 盲目覆盖安装:未卸载旧版直接安装新版 .spk,导致配置文件冲突;✅ 正确做法:先停用服务 → 备份 /var/packages/OpenClaw/target/etc/ → 彻底卸载 → 清理残留目录;
  • ❌ 忽略 glibc 版本锁:DSM 7.2 默认 glibc 2.33,但部分 OpenClaw 二进制要求 2.28;✅ 需比对 strings /lib/libc.so.6 | grep GLIBC_ 输出,不匹配则不可强运行;
  • ❌ 日志路径硬编码:某些版本将日志写死到 /usr/local/OpenClaw/var/log(只读分区);✅ 手动修改启动脚本 /var/packages/OpenClaw/scripts/start-stop-status 中的 LOG_DIR 变量;
  • ❌ 信任非签名包:从非 GitHub 官源下载 .spk,存在植入恶意脚本风险;✅ 仅使用 release 页面带 GPG 签名的包,并校验 SHA256。

FAQ

OpenClaw(龙虾)靠谱吗?是否合规?

OpenClaw(龙虾)为开源项目(MIT 协议),代码可审计,无数据回传行为;但其非群晖认证应用,安装需关闭「套件来源限制」,存在一定系统权限风险。合规性取决于使用方式——仅采集公开页面数据(如商品标题、价格)通常无法律风险;若绕过 API 限制高频请求,可能触发平台反爬机制,需自行评估风控策略。

OpenClaw(龙虾)适合哪些卖家?

适用于:已部署群晖 NAS、具备基础命令行操作能力、需低成本自建轻量级监控(如多店铺价格比价、竞品上新提醒)的中小跨境卖家;不推荐给无 Linux 经验的新手,或依赖稳定 SLA 的品牌出海团队(建议选用 SaaS 类成熟工具)。

OpenClaw(龙虾)常见失败原因是什么?如何排查?

最常见失败原因:① 架构 mismatch(ARM 包装在 x86 NAS);② DSM 升级后 glibc 不兼容;③ 缺失 libstdc++ 导致动态链接失败。排查必须顺序执行:查看 DSM 兼容列表 → 运行 ldd 检查依赖 → 检查 openclaw.log 最末三行报错 → 验证 /var/packages/OpenClaw/target/bin/openclaw 是否有执行权限(chmod +x)。

结尾

OpenClaw(龙虾)闪退可修,但需严格匹配环境;建议优先确认官方是否提供 DSM 7.2+ 正式支持版本。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业